  Discussion on Rabies Detected in my Area
Author Message

Posted on Wednesday, Aug 15, 2001 - 11:55 am:

Hi-
My horses were both given rabies shots (one in February, one in April, 2001). Our local wildlife officer made an "official visit" to us yesterday, telling us that they had an official case of rabies in a raccoon in the area - we live on a river, so he said to watch out for infected animals.
Question- Should I get the vet to give the horses another rabies shot just in case?
Thanks!

Posted on Wednesday, Aug 15, 2001 - 3:28 pm:

I think this may be prudent if it has been more than 6 months. We currently do not believe the vaccine is as dependable in horses as it is in dogs.
DrO
